Personal Electronic Devices Procedure

Longhill High School recognises that personal electronic devices can have a number of positive uses, including for safety and entertainment purposes. Nevertheless, their use in school often results in unwelcome distractions from learning. Therefore, PEDs are not permitted to be used, seen or heard during the school day – this is any time the school is open and students are on-site. Failing to adhere to this expectation will result in the following:

Parents and carers should support this by contacting the school if they need to get a message to their child during the school day rather than calling or sending messages directly to their child. Similarly, if their child needs to contact home urgently, they must go to student services.
